{"id":822,"date":"2020-10-24T16:22:14","date_gmt":"2020-10-24T16:22:14","guid":{"rendered":"http:\/\/mp4gain.com\/nl\/audio-video\/?p=822"},"modified":"2020-10-24T16:22:14","modified_gmt":"2020-10-24T16:22:14","slug":"lossless-compressie-hoe-het-werkt","status":"publish","type":"post","link":"https:\/\/mp4gain.com\/nl\/audio-video\/audio-converter\/lossless-compressie-hoe-het-werkt\/","title":{"rendered":"Lossless compressie &#8211; hoe het werkt"},"content":{"rendered":"<p><strong>Lossless compressie &#8211; hoe het werkt<\/strong><br \/>\nAls de kopie niet verschilt van het origineel.<\/p>\n<p><img decoding=\"async\" src=\"https:\/\/blog.twentyoverten.com\/assets\/Lossy-vs-Lossless-334x425.png\" alt=\"Lossless compression\" \/><\/p>\n<p>Lossless compressie &#8211; hoe het werkt<br \/>\nWe hebben al ontdekt hoe geluid wordt gedigitaliseerd. Een van de problemen: als we het met hoge kwaliteit digitaliseren, dan hebben we veel data nodig, dat wil zeggen grote bestanden, een groot verbruik van schijfruimte, dure flash drives, veel internetverkeer. Ik zou graag willen dat de bestanden kleiner zijn.<img decoding=\"async\" src=\"https:\/\/techdifferences.com\/wp-content\/uploads\/2017\/10\/Untitled-1.jpg\" alt=\"Lossy Compression and Lossless Compression\" \/><\/p>\n<p>Hiervoor wordt compressie gebruikt &#8211; verschillende algoritmen die hun magie doen met de gegevens en de uitvoer is gegevens van een kleiner volume.<\/p>\n<p>Lossy en lossless compressie<br \/>\nEr zijn twee hoofdtypen compressie: lossy en lossless.<\/p>\n<p>Lossy-compressie betekent dat we tijdens het proces wat informatie zijn kwijtgeraakt. Lossy-compressie-algoritmen proberen ervoor te zorgen dat we alleen gegevens verliezen die niet al te belangrijk voor ons zijn.<\/p>\n<p>Stel je voor dat compressie met verlies een korte herhaling is van een schoolcurriculumwerk: de student is niet zo belangrijk over de beschrijving van de aard en stijl van de auteur, het belangrijkste is de plot. De korte telling hield alleen vast wat belangrijk was, maar bracht het veel sneller over.<\/p>\n<p>Lossless compressie is wanneer we de grootte van het bestand verkleinen, zonder kwaliteitsverlies. Hiervoor worden interessante wiskundige en coderingstechnieken gebruikt. Het belangrijkste idee is dat tijdens het decoderen alle gegevens op hun plaats blijven.<\/p>\n<p>Lossless compressie-algoritmen<br \/>\nEr zijn twee hoofdopties: het Huffman-algoritme of de LZW. LZW wordt overal gebruikt, maar is vrij moeilijk uit te leggen, niet intu\u00eftief en vereist een volledige lezing. Het is veel beter om het Huffman-algoritme uit te leggen.<\/p>\n<p>Het algoritme van Huffman neemt het bestand, splitst het in stukken, wat handig is om mee te werken, en kijkt vervolgens naar hoe vaak elk fragment voorkomt. Het algoritme duidt de meest voorkomende woorden aan met een korte code en de zeldzaamste met een langere code. Omdat de meest voorkomende woorden nu veel minder ruimte innemen, wordt het voltooide bestand kleiner.<\/p>\n<p>Maar er is ook een keerzijde: soms moet u deze woord- en codecorrespondentietabel rechtstreeks in hetzelfde bestand opslaan, maar het kan op zichzelf al groot zijn. Meestal wordt het Huffman-algoritme gebruikt voor verliesloze compressie van tekst- en videobestanden.<\/p>\n<p>Hier is een voorbeeld: neem het nummer Beyonce &#8211; All The Single Ladies. Er zijn daar twee van dergelijke passages:<\/p>\n<p>Alle alleenstaande vrouwen<\/p>\n<p>Alle alleenstaande vrouwen<\/p>\n<p>Alle alleenstaande vrouwen<\/p>\n<p>Doe nu je handen in de lucht<\/p>\n<p>&#8230;<\/p>\n<p>Als je het leuk vindt, moet je er een ring omheen doen<\/p>\n<p>Als je het leuk vindt, moet je er een ring omheen doen<\/p>\n<p>Wees niet boos als je eenmaal ziet dat hij het wil<\/p>\n<p>Als je het leuk vindt, moet je er een ring omheen doen<\/p>\n<p>Hier zijn 281 borden. We zien dat sommige regels worden herhaald. Laten we ze coderen:<\/p>\n<p>COMPRESSIE TABEL<\/p>\n<p>\\ a \\ Alle alleenstaande vrouwen<\/p>\n<p>\\ b \\ Steek nu uw handen omhoog<\/p>\n<p>\\ c \\ Als het je bevalt, dan had je er een ring om moeten doen<\/p>\n<p>\\ d \\ Wees niet boos als je eenmaal ziet dat hij het wil<\/p>\n<p>SONG TEXT<\/p>\n<p>\\ a \\ \\ a \\ \\ a \\ \\ b \\<\/p>\n<p>&#8230;<\/p>\n<p>\\ c \\ \\ c \\ \\ d \\ \\ c \\<\/p>\n<p>Samen met de compressietabel beslaat deze tekst nu 187 tekens; we hebben de tekst met bijna een derde gecomprimeerd omdat het nogal eentonig is.<\/p>\n<p>Lossless compressie met audio als voorbeeld<br \/>\nGemiddeld neemt een minuut ongecomprimeerde audio 10 megabyte in beslag. Dat is best veel: als je bijvoorbeeld een concert van een uur hebt opgenomen, kost dat een halve gigabyte. Aan de andere kant legt deze opname alle nuances van geluid vast, er zijn veel hoge frequenties en schoonheid in het algemeen.<\/p>\n<p>Voor dergelijke situaties wordt verliesloze compressie gebruikt: het bestand wordt 2 tot 3 keer verkleind zonder het geluid te vervormen. De algoritmen die de audio comprimeren, worden codecs genoemd. FLAC en Apple Lossless zijn twee populaire lossless audiocompressiecodecs.<\/p>\n<p>Vergelijk zelf de grootte en kwaliteit van de audio van twee minuten:<\/p>\n<p>Origineel: ongecomprimeerd WAV-formaat, 23 megabytes<\/p>\n<p>Lossless-compressie: FLAC-indeling met dezelfde parameters als WAV, 10 megabytes<\/p>\n<p>Waar wordt anders verliesloze compressie gebruikt?<br \/>\nIn archiefkasten. De taak van het archiveren van programma&#8217;s is om geselecteerde bestanden zo te verpakken dat het bestand zo min mogelijk ruimte inneemt, zonder de inhoud te beschadigen. De tekstversie van &#8220;Oorlog en vrede&#8221; kan bijvoorbeeld 4 megabytes zijn en de gearchiveerde versie 100 kilobytes 40 keer minder.<\/p>\n<p>Bij het programmeren. Er zijn speciale wrappers die een kant-en-klaar programma gebruiken en de code optimaliseren zodat deze minder ruimte inneemt, maar zijn functionaliteit behoudt. Bijvoorbeeld:<\/p>\n<p>Verwijder opmerkingen<br \/>\nMinimaliseer functie- en variabelenamen<br \/>\nVerwijder tekens die nodig zijn voor menselijke leesbaarheid<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Lossless compressie &#8211; hoe het werkt Als de kopie niet verschilt van het origineel. Lossless compressie &#8211; hoe het werkt We hebben al ontdekt hoe geluid wordt gedigitaliseerd. Een van de problemen: als we het met hoge kwaliteit digitaliseren, dan hebben we veel data nodig, dat wil zeggen grote bestanden, een groot verbruik van schijfruimte, &hellip; <a href=\"https:\/\/mp4gain.com\/nl\/audio-video\/audio-converter\/lossless-compressie-hoe-het-werkt\/\" class=\"more-link\">Continue reading<span class=\"screen-reader-text\"> &#8220;Lossless compressie &#8211; hoe het werkt&#8221;<\/span><\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[1345],"tags":[18434,19623,19625,19626,10557,19630,19629,19631,19635,19634,19622,3651,19624,19627,10569,10570,19613,19628,3653,19632,19633,10560,19621,10566],"class_list":["post-822","post","type-post","status-publish","format-standard","hentry","category-audio-converter","tag-algemeen-verliesvrij-audiobestandsformaat","tag-amazon-lossless-audio","tag-audio-lossless-bestand","tag-audio-lossless-formaat","tag-heeft-spotify-audio-zonder-verlies","tag-hoe-u-lossless-audio-kunt-controleren","tag-hoe-u-lossless-audio-kunt-downloaden-van-itunes","tag-hoe-u-lossless-audio-kunt-rippen","tag-is-apple-lossless-audiofiele-kwaliteit","tag-is-wav-audio-zonder-verlies","tag-kan-stream-lossless-audio-uitzenden","tag-klinkt-lossless-audio-beter","tag-lossless-bluetooth-audio","tag-verkoopt-amazon-verliesloze-audio","tag-waar-u-lossless-audio-kunt-kopen","tag-waar-u-lossless-audio-kunt-krijgen","tag-waarom-geen-lossless-audio-bluetooth-reddit","tag-wat-betekent-gratis-verliesloze-audiocodec","tag-wat-betekent-lossless-audio","tag-wat-is-apple-lossless-audiobestand","tag-wat-is-gratis-verliesloze-audiocodec-flac","tag-wat-is-lossless-audio","tag-wat-zijn-lossless-audioformaten","tag-welk-verliesvrij-audioformaat-het-beste-is"],"_links":{"self":[{"href":"https:\/\/mp4gain.com\/nl\/audio-video\/wp-json\/wp\/v2\/posts\/822","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/mp4gain.com\/nl\/audio-video\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/mp4gain.com\/nl\/audio-video\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/mp4gain.com\/nl\/audio-video\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/mp4gain.com\/nl\/audio-video\/wp-json\/wp\/v2\/comments?post=822"}],"version-history":[{"count":1,"href":"https:\/\/mp4gain.com\/nl\/audio-video\/wp-json\/wp\/v2\/posts\/822\/revisions"}],"predecessor-version":[{"id":823,"href":"https:\/\/mp4gain.com\/nl\/audio-video\/wp-json\/wp\/v2\/posts\/822\/revisions\/823"}],"wp:attachment":[{"href":"https:\/\/mp4gain.com\/nl\/audio-video\/wp-json\/wp\/v2\/media?parent=822"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/mp4gain.com\/nl\/audio-video\/wp-json\/wp\/v2\/categories?post=822"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/mp4gain.com\/nl\/audio-video\/wp-json\/wp\/v2\/tags?post=822"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}